🌍 4) How to Invest in SpaceX IPO from India

Indian investors cannot directly apply like Indian IPOs, but here are options:

✅ Option 1: Invest via US Stock Brokers

Use platforms like:

Steps:

  1. Open US stock account
  2. Complete KYC
  3. Fund via LRS (₹7 lakh+/year allowed)
  4. Buy shares after listing

⚠️ Risks for Indian Investors

  • Currency risk (USD vs INR)
  • High valuation (overpriced risk)
  • Market volatility
  • IPO hype
